Nursing Supervisor Behavioral Health

Anuvia Prevention & Recovery Center
Charlotte, NC

Anuvia is seeking a seasoned and forward-thinkingNursingSupervisorto oversee clinical performance and operational coordination of a contractednursingservices agency, as well as provide leadership to Anuvia-employednursingstaff within select programs. This individual will serve as the primary liaison between Anuvia and the contracted agency, ensuring high-quality, compliant, and integrated medical care delivery across Detox, Residential, Shelter, and ACTT teams. The role requires a proactive, hands-on leader with strong clinical judgment, administrative insight, and a collaborative spirit.Work Schedule: Monday-Friday 8am-4:30pmKey ResponsibilitiesOversight of ContractedNursingServices
  • Serve as the organizational lead in managing the relationship with the contractednursingagency.
  • Monitor agency compliance with contractual agreements, clinical protocols, and regulatory standards.
  • Participate in vendor performance evaluations and recommend corrective actions or contract adjustments when needed.
  • Facilitate onboarding, orientation, and integration of contract nurses into Anuvia’s operational workflows and culture.
Supervision of InternalNursingOperations
  • Provide direct supervision to any Anuvia-employed nurses, including those serving the Shelter and ACTT teams (dotted-line reporting).
  • Coordinate clinical collaboration between contract staff and Anuvianursingemployees to ensure seamless care transitions and communication.
  • Develop and maintain coverage plans that ensure adequatenursingpresence across all service lines.
Clinical Quality and Compliance
  • Ensure adherence to statenursingboard standards, CARF requirements, and internal clinical protocols.
  • Oversee medication administration compliance, infection control procedures, and incident reporting processes.
  • Conduct periodic audits ofnursingdocumentation, including chart reviews and medication records.
Training and Development
  • Lead training initiatives for Anuvia-employed and designated non-medical staff in medication administration, emergency response (First Aid, CPR, AED), and other relevant clinical topics.
  • Collaborate with the Clinical Director to identify skill gaps and provide targeted development plans.
Administrative and Strategic Responsibilities
  • Participate in Quality Improvement (QI) and Quality Assurance (QA) efforts, including data collection, reporting, and trend analysis.
  • Contribute to the design and revision of policies impactingnursingfunctions.
  • Serve on internal committees and act as a representative voice fornursingacross cross-functional initiatives.
Qualifications
  • Education:RN required; BSN preferred.
  • Licensure:Active NC Registered Nurse license required.
  • Experience:Minimum of 5 years of clinicalnursingexperience, including at least 1 year in a supervisory or lead role. Experience managing third-party healthcare vendors or contract staff preferred.
